What Commercial Auto Covers
Auto Liability for bodily injury and property damage to others
Combined Single Limit options that meet contract and lender requirements
Personal Injury Protection and MedPay as required in Florida
Uninsured and Underinsured Motorist for at-fault drivers who lack insurance
Comprehensive for theft, fire, vandalism, and storm damage
Collision for crashes with another vehicle or object
Towing and Roadside options for disabled vehicles
Rental Reimbursement while your vehicle is in the shop
We size limits to contracts and budgets. Common limits include 1 million combined single limit.
Smart Add-Ons For Florida Risks
Hired and Non-Owned Auto (HNOA): when employees drive their own cars or rented vehicles for business
Drive Other Car: coverage for owners and executives who do not have a personal auto policy
Employer’s Non-Ownership Liability: for incidental employee use
Trailer Interchange and Non-Owned Trailer Physical Damage
Motor Truck Cargo for transported goods and tools
Rental Car Physical Damage for hired vehicles
Garagekeepers if you service or park customer vehicles
MCS-90 and state or federal filings if your operation requires them
What Is Not Covered
Employee injuries. Use Workers Compensation
Damage to your building or equipment off the vehicle. Use Commercial Property or Inland Marine
Professional errors or contracts. Use General Liability or Professional Liability
Intentional acts and routine maintenance issues

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need commercial auto if I already have personal auto?
Yes, if the vehicle is used for business or titled to the business, you need a commercial policy.
Is Hired and Non-Owned Auto the same as rental car coverage?
HNOA provides liability for vehicles you hire or employees own. Add hired auto physical damage if you want damage coverage for rented vehicles.
Can I insure tools and equipment kept in the vehicle
Tools are better covered under Inland Marine or Contractors Equipment with theft protection.
What limits do contracts usually require
Many contracts require 1 million CSL for auto liability. We will match your contract requirements.
How fast can I get ID cards
Often the same day once your policy is active.

How Pricing Works in Florida
Premium is based on vehicle type and radius, garaging location, driver history and MVRs, business class, annual mileage, selected limits and deductibles, and loss history. Credits may apply for telematics, driver training, and garaging security.
